Ripple Asks to Investigate 15 Crypto Exchanges to Prove Innocence
Ripple CEO Brad Garlinghouse and co-founder Chris Larsen have filed a motion with the court asking the US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) to investigate several cryptocurrency exchanges;
Google Lifts Ban for Limited Crypto Ads
Google has updated its financial products and services policy, according to which, advertisers can submit requests for advertisements focused on cryptocurrency exchanges and digital wallets targeting the United States;
ECB: Not Launching a Digital Currency Poses Risks
The European Central Bank (ECB) yesterday published a report on the international role of the euro in which the regulator says that issuing central bank digital currencies (CBDCs) is necessary to ensure financial stability;
SEC Pushes Back Verdict on WisdomTree's Bitcoin ETF
The US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) has delayed another application for bitcoin exchange-traded fund (ETF) until July.
